Vehicle overview
The Electromagnetic Spectrum (EMS) Services for Operations / Electromagnetic Environmental Effects (E3) Engineering and Strategic Planning Support is a multiple-award IDIQ managed by the Defense Information Systems Agency (DISA). It provides spectrum analysis, engineering, strategic planning, and operational support across defense and telecommunications domains. The vehicle has a shared ceiling of $137 million and has obligated approximately $64 million since its inception in 2016.
Work categories include electromagnetic environmental effects (E3) engineering, spectrum sharing analyses, wireless services coordination, and test and demonstration projects. Some task orders utilize total or partial small business set-asides.
EMS Services contract holders
| Contractor | Obligated | Task orders |
|---|---|---|
| PERATON INC. | $40.3M | 10 |
| AMENTUM SERVICES, INC. | $11.2M | 3 |
| CALVERT SYSTEMS ENGINEERING, INC | $5.0M | 3 |
| EXPRESSION NETWORKS LLC | $3.7M | 3 |
| HII MISSION TECHNOLOGIES CORP | $3.1M | 2 |
| FREEDOM TECHNOLOGIES, INCORPORATED | $488.1K | 2 |
| ANDRO COMPUTATIONAL SOLUTIONS LLC | $1.8K | 1 |
| COSOLUTIONS INC | $141 | 1 |
